In this guide, we'll explore standard bench dimensions, ideal sizes for various table types, and tips for maximizing your dining space.Standard Bench DimensionsThe typical dining room bench is designed to complement your dining table, creating a cohesive look. Standard bench dimensions generally range from 48 to 72 inches in length, with a height of about 18 to 20 inches. The depth usually varies between 14 to 18 inches, allowing for comfortable seating without taking up too much space. These dimensions accommodate most dining tables, especially those with a width of 30 to 40 inches.Choosing the Right Size for Your TableIt's important to consider the table size when selecting a bench. For example, if you have a rectangular table that is 72 inches long, a 60-inch bench would be ideal, leaving a comfortable gap on either end for easy movement. Similarly, for round tables, a shorter bench may be more appropriate to ensure that guests can easily slide in and out.Multi-Functional BenchesIf you're working with a small dining area, consider using a multi-functional bench that can serve as both seating and storage. These benches typically have a similar height and length as standard benches but may include additional features such as built-in storage compartments. Ensure that the dimensions still accommodate the dining table comfortably.Tips for Maximizing SpaceTo maximize your space, choose benches that can be tucked underneath the dining table when not in use. This not only keeps your dining area looking neat but also allows for free movement around the table. Additionally, consider the material of the bench.
